A view of Mérida

Day trip from Badajoz to Mérida by bus

Why visit Mérida for the day?

Mérida is best known for its Roman heritage, especially the theatre, amphitheatre and monumental ruins across the city. As Extremadura’s capital, it mixes major archaeology with a relaxed everyday atmosphere.

How to get from Badajoz to Mérida by bus?

There are 5 buses per day. The earliest bus runs at 09:00, the last at 21:20. The fastest bus covers the 33 miles (54 km) distance in 55m.

A view of Cáceres

Day trip from Badajoz to Cáceres by bus

Why visit Cáceres for the day?

Cáceres is known for one of Spain's best preserved medieval old quarters, filled with palaces, towers, and old stone streets. Its UNESCO-listed center reflects Roman, Islamic, Gothic, and Renaissance layers in a calm Extremaduran setting.

How to get from Badajoz to Cáceres by bus?

There are 5 buses per day. The earliest bus runs at 07:15, the last at 18:45. The fastest bus covers the 52 miles (84 km) distance in 2h 0m.

A view of Elvas

Day trip from Badajoz to Elvas by bus

Why visit Elvas for the day?

Elvas is a fortified city in Portugal’s Alentejo near the Spanish border. It is best known for its UNESCO-listed walls, aqueduct, and calm historic streets shaped by military history.

How to get from Badajoz to Elvas by bus?

There are 4 buses per day. The earliest bus runs at 14:25, the last at 14:25. The fastest bus covers the 10 miles (17 km) distance in 20m.

A view of Évora

Day trip from Badajoz to Évora by bus

Why visit Évora for the day?

Évora is known for its Roman temple and its walled medieval center in the Alentejo. Whitewashed streets, quiet squares, and a long university tradition give it a calm, historic character.

How to get from Badajoz to Évora by bus?

There are 4 buses per day. The earliest bus runs at 05:00, the last at 21:45. The fastest bus covers the 54 miles (88 km) distance in 1h 15m.

Badajoz is a city located in southwestern Spain, near the border with Portugal. Known for its rich history and cultural heritage, it offers visitors a unique destination to explore. With its stunning architecture, including the impressive Alcazaba fortress and the majestic Cathedral of San Juan Bautista, Badajoz showcases the grandeur of its past. The city's charming old town, filled with narrow streets and picturesque squares, invites travelers to wander and discover its hidden gems. Additionally, Badajoz boasts a vibrant culinary scene, where visitors can indulge in traditional Spanish dishes and regional specialties. BlaBlaCar

About
BlaBlaCar is a French online marketplace for carpooling, connecting drivers with empty seats and passengers traveling to the same destination to share costs. Founded in 2006, it operates in Europe and Latin America, boasting 26 million active members. The platform also includes BlaBlaCar Bus, an intercity bus service. BlaBlaCar's name comes from its rating system for drivers' chattiness: "Bla" for quiet, "BlaBla" for talkative, and "BlaBlaBla" for very chatty. The company aims to be the leading marketplace for shared travel, offering affordable and sustainable solutions by combining carpooling with bus journeys.

  • Must visit

Museo Arqueológico Provincial de Badajoz

Archaeological museum inside the Alcazaba with major prehistoric, Roman, Visigothic, and Islamic collections essential to understanding Badajoz.

  • Recommended

MEIAC Museo Extremeño e Iberoamericano de Arte Contemporáneo

Leading contemporary art museum in Extremadura, known for strong Spanish and Portuguese collections and a bold modern building near the river.

  • Recommended

Museo de Bellas Artes de Badajoz

Fine arts museum showcasing painting and sculpture linked to Badajoz and Extremadura. A rewarding stop for regional artistic heritage.

Euro (€)

More affordable than Madrid or Barcelona, with lower hotel rates, good-value dining, and inexpensive local transport for visitors.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-12 for a budget meal.
Mid-range
€18-30 per person for a mid-range meal.
Fine dining
€45+ per person for fine dining.
Coffee
€1.50-2.50 for coffee.

Tipping culture

Tipping is optional. Round up or leave 5-10% in restaurants for good service; round up in taxis; small change is fine in cafes.
